This commit makes the downloader found in `mirror::operation::download`
stateless by removing the `preferred_authority` field and changing all
methods from `&mut self` to `&self`.
The preferred authority is now accepted as a parameter to
`DownloadManager::download` which also returns a tuple now with the
actually used authority alongside the response, putting the management
of this to the responsibility of the caller.
Meanwhile, it also renames the structure from `ConsensusBoundDownloader`
to `DownloadManager` because it no longer keeps a state that
invalidates after a consensus "ends".
The purpose of this is to simplify overall state in order to make the
implementation of a finite-state-machine for the dirmirror operation
more easy (and deterministic).

This commit fixes the flaky `request_fail_ultimately` in tor-dirserver,
which is flaky due to the operating system's handling of TCP RSTs, which
are generally detected stochastically and sometimes are not received
even after the entire response has been parsed.
This leads to tor-dirclient either returning a connection reset or a
truncated header error, depending on whether it successfully or
unsuccessfully reads zero bytes from the server.
Fixes #2318

This commit rpelaces the use of `INSERT` with `INSERT OR REPLACE` for
handling insertion conflicts in `store_insert`.
Because everything is content-addressed anyways, it does not matter to
do this, because if we get a conflict on a SHA256, it means the data is
equal.[1]
[1]: Excluding SHA-2 collisions which are impractical as of 2026.

This commit speeds up the tests in `tor-dirserver` by using
functionality from Tokio's `test-util`.
Most notably, it runs the time intensive test in paused mode, which
means that the clock gets advanced either explicitly or implicitly using
auto-advance in case the runtime has nothing to do.
In our case, the last one, auto-advancing, is used, leading to our
sleep calls returning immediately.
This is good enough for testing in this module. It is not the
responsibility of tor-dirserver to ensure whether `RetryDelay` returns
proper values, as this is the responsibility of `tor-basic-utils`.
Still, it is a bit unfortunate that Tokio offers no way to manually
disbale the auto-advancing. In the future, it might be useful to
migrate more parts of this to crate to `tor-rtcompat`, but for now, this
change is a good enough performance fix.

This commit eliminates the use of sleep in database tests because those
can be flaky, especially when the CI scheduler is overloaded, leading to
potential timeout invariants not holding true anymore.
We now fix this by using synchronization primitives from Rust in order
for threads to communicate. Documentation has been added explaining how
these tests work in greater detail.
Fixes #2308

SQLite does not support u64 and the new version of SQLite makes a
certain piece of tor-dirserver no longer compile due to the lack of
`ToSql` for `u64`. This commit fixes it by converting these types from
`u64` to `i64` saturatingly.

This commit refactors `get_recent_consensus()` in `tor-dirserver` to use
a single SQL statement with the power of `INNER JOIN` instead of two SQL
statements querying the store after retrieving the SHA256 hash.
The primary motivation for this is to have cleaner code.
A single SQL statement is often-times easier to comprehend, as well more
performant in execution, although that can only be proven with a
profiler and is not of much concern, given that this function is only
executed roughly every 60-90min.

This commit makes the entire database operations synchronous, thereby
replacing deadpool with r2d2.
The full motivation is outlined in a rustdoc comment at the top of the
`database` module, but it can be summarized to the fact that SQLite is
by design inherently synchronous due to directly interfacing with the
file system.
